FSLogix Profile Containers. Failed to delete C:\Users\local_username (The directory is not empty.) (Access is denied.)

I am having an issue where some of the FSLogix temporary folders do not get deleted when the user logs off. The next time they log in, they will get a folder C:\Users\local_username1 (where the '1' is appended to the end).
This causes issues with some programs; they will error trying to access the users %TEMP% or %TMP%.
The error in C:\ProgramData\FSLogix\Logs\Profile states that:
Failed to delete C:\Users\local_username (The directory is not empty.)
Failed to delete C:\Users\local_username (Access is denied.)

Here is some background information:

  • Windows Server 2019 Standard [10.0.17763 N/A Build 17763]
  • Microsoft FSlogix Apps [2.9.7654.46150]
  • Six (6) Servers in the collection. Aproximately 80 users per server.
  • VHD located on a Samba share; RAID 10; good performance
  • Policies
    Administrative Templates
    FSLogix
    Days to keep log files Enabled 1
    Enable logging Enabled All logs enabled
    FSLogix/Profile Containers
    Delete local profile when FSLogix Profile should apply Enabled
    Enabled Enabled
    VHD location Enabled \SOMESERVER\Profiles
    FSLogix/Profile Containers/Advanced
    Keep local folder after user logs out Disabled
    Redirect temporary file folders to local computer Enabled Redirect TEMP, TMP and INetCache to local drive

Any suggestions would be appreciated.
